Output 31bdf900c67902e8c625d1d868745273a4b3bcc6990c62273b2f8d4db29a7e3a:1

value
2385755
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8efbe19ba68eb11fda4b14b55c79db40ddb892c1 OP_EQUALVERIFY OP_CHECKSIG
address
1E32hFySYT6BnUo6HvNjceD8seS7EmRc1S
transaction
31bdf900c67902e8c625d1d868745273a4b3bcc6990c62273b2f8d4db29a7e3a
spent
true